Each of the answers will be numbered and mentioned with a sentence in correct Spanish based on the poem: "Canción de Pirata."
<h3>What does the poem "
Canción del Pirata" reflect?</h3>
The aforementioned poem by José de Espronceda reflects the feeling of the pirate during the golden age of piracy, where some audacious sailors preferred to dedicate their lives to stealing ships and live a large part of their lives at sea.
Regarding the questions asked, the answers respectively are:
- El autor siente el mar como su hogar, como su verdadera patria.
- La frase que identifica lo anterior es "mi única patria, la mar".
- No tengo el mismo sentimiento que tiene el autor por el mar.
- Lo anterior se debe a que no estoy tan familiarizado con el mar como los piratas de la época dorada, así como tengo otras aficiones que distan de la vida en el mar.
